Opening Hours & Best Time to Visit Wat Khao Takiab (Thailand)
Planning your visit to Wat Khao Takiab? Knowing the best time to visit will ensure you have a memorable experience. Here's a quick guide to help you plan your trip.
- Opening Hours: The temple is generally open from 6:00 AM to 6:00 PM daily.
- Best Time to Visit: The best time to visit is early in the morning (6:00 AM - 9:00 AM) or late in the afternoon (4:00 PM - 6:00 PM) to avoid the midday heat and the larger tour groups. Weekdays tend to be less busy than weekends. The months of November to February offer the most pleasant weather.
- Estimated Visit Duration: Allow approximately 2-3 hours to fully explore the temple and enjoy the surrounding views.
Location Details about Wat Khao Takiab (Thailand)
Want to know where is Wat Khao Takiab? This iconic temple is easily accessible and offers a rewarding experience. Here’s what you need to know about its location.
- Address: Khao Takiab, Hua Hin, Prachuap Khiri Khan 77110, Thailand.
- Parking Availability: There is ample parking available at the base of the hill near the temple entrance.
- Wheelchair Accessibility: While the base of the temple is accessible, reaching the main temple requires climbing stairs, making it unfortunately not fully wheelchair accessible.
How Much to Enter / Visit Wat Khao Takiab (Thailand)
Planning a visit to Wat Khao Takiab and wondering about tickets and entry fees? Here’s what you need to know to plan your visit.
- Entry Fee: Admission to Wat Khao Takiab is free. However, donations are welcome and appreciated to help maintain the temple.
- Pricing Variations: There are no pricing variations between weekends and weekdays, or for adults and children, as entry is free for all.
How To Go to Wat Khao Takiab (Thailand)
Figuring out how to go to Wat Khao Takiab is easy with a few transport options. Here’s a simple guide to get you there.

- Taxi: Taxis are readily available in Hua Hin and can take you directly to the temple. Negotiate the fare beforehand.
- Local Bus: Local buses (songthaews) run along the main road and can drop you off near Khao Takiab. Look for the green buses heading south from Hua Hin town.
- Motorbike Rental: Renting a motorbike is a popular option for exploring the area. The ride to Wat Khao Takiab is straightforward and offers scenic views.
Things To Do in or near the Wat Khao Takiab
Looking for nearby attractions and activities around Wat Khao Takiab? There's plenty to see and do in this beautiful area. Here are some ideas to make the most of your visit.
- Activities in Wat Khao Takiab:
- Climb to the Temple: Ascend the steps to the temple at the summit for panoramic coastal views.
- Interact with Monkeys: Observe and interact with the resident monkeys (but be cautious and keep food secure).
- Visit the Giant Buddha Statue: Admire the large Buddha statue overlooking the sea.
- Explore the Caves: Discover small caves and shrines within the temple complex.
- Enjoy the Viewpoint: Take in the breathtaking views of Hua Hin and the surrounding coastline.
- Activities Nearby Wat Khao Takiab:
- Khao Takiab Beach: Relax and soak up the sun on this beautiful beach.
- Cicada Market: Visit this vibrant weekend market for local crafts, food, and entertainment.
- Rajabhakti Park: Explore this historical park featuring giant statues of Thai kings.
- Hua Hin Floating Market: Experience the charm of a traditional floating market.
- Vana Nava Water Jungle: Have a fun-filled day at this popular water park.

Tips To Go to Wat Khao Takiab (Thailand) and Safety Tips
Planning a trip to Wat Khao Takiab? Here are some essential tips and safety guidelines to ensure a smooth and enjoyable visit.
- What to Bring:
- Sunscreen: Protect your skin from the strong Thai sun.
- Hat: A hat will provide extra shade and keep you cool.
- Water: Stay hydrated, especially when climbing the stairs to the temple.
- Insect Repellent: Mosquitoes can be present, particularly in the evening.
- Modest Clothing: Dress respectfully when visiting the temple (cover shoulders and knees).
- Snacks for Monkeys (Optional): If you plan to feed the monkeys, bring fruits or nuts, but be cautious.
- Tourist Safety Tips:
- Be Aware of Monkeys: Monkeys can be mischievous and may try to grab food or belongings. Keep a close eye on your items.
- Stay Hydrated: Drink plenty of water to avoid heatstroke.
- Watch Your Step: The stairs to the temple can be steep and uneven.
- Secure Your Belongings: Be mindful of your belongings to prevent theft.
- Respect Local Customs: Be respectful of the temple and local traditions.
